Go to MYRIDE.COM for more car videos. The MINI Cooper offers a combination of personality, size, quality of engineering and driving enjoyment. With this combination of attributes, MINI has established the small premium car segment in the US The MINI Cooper is powered by a four-cylinder 1.6 liter 16-valve engine. The engine delivers approximately 115 hp and 111lb/ft of torque, achieves a 0-60 time of 8.5 seconds, a top speed of 124 mph and a fuel consumption of 28/36 mpg city/higway.
